Samsung Power Freeze: The Ultimate Guide to Rapid Cooling
Samsung Power Freeze is a remarkable function available on select Samsung refrigerators that drastically accelerates the freezing process. In essence, it rapidly lowers the temperature of the freezer compartment, allowing you to freeze food items much faster than in normal operation. This not only preserves the food’s texture and flavor more effectively but also comes in handy for making ice quickly when you need it most.
Diving Deeper into Power Freeze Technology
Think of it as a turbo boost for your freezer. While standard freezers gradually lower temperatures to reach freezing point, Power Freeze mode kicks the compressor into high gear, significantly reducing the time it takes to freeze items solid. This rapid freezing is crucial because slower freezing can lead to the formation of larger ice crystals within the food, which can damage cellular structures and result in a loss of texture and flavor upon thawing.
Power Freeze isn’t just about speed; it’s about quality. By minimizing ice crystal formation, it helps maintain the integrity of your food. Whether you’re freezing fresh produce, meat, or leftovers, this technology helps lock in the freshness and flavor, ensuring that when you eventually thaw and cook the food, it tastes as close as possible to how it did before freezing.
Furthermore, the speed at which Power Freeze operates is particularly useful for tasks such as rapidly chilling drinks or solidifying homemade ice cream mixtures. It’s a convenient and versatile feature that enhances the functionality of your refrigerator.

1. How do I activate Power Freeze on my Samsung refrigerator?
Activating Power Freeze is typically straightforward. The precise method can vary slightly depending on your specific Samsung refrigerator model. However, in most cases, you’ll find a dedicated “Power Freeze” button on the refrigerator’s control panel, usually located on the door or inside the refrigerator compartment. Simply press this button to activate the mode. The display panel will usually indicate that Power Freeze is active, often with a specific icon or illuminated text. Consult your refrigerator’s user manual for detailed instructions specific to your model.
2. How long does Power Freeze typically take to freeze food items?
The exact time it takes for Power Freeze to freeze food items depends on several factors, including the quantity of food being frozen, the initial temperature of the food, and the freezer’s existing temperature. However, as a general guideline, Power Freeze can reduce freezing time by as much as 20-50% compared to regular freezing. Smaller items can freeze solid in as little as a few hours, while larger items might take longer. The rapid chilling effect is noticeable within the first hour.
3. Is it safe to leave Power Freeze on for extended periods?
While Power Freeze is designed for rapid cooling, it’s not intended for continuous use. Leaving it on for extended periods can potentially lead to excessive energy consumption and may put unnecessary strain on the compressor. Once the food is frozen or the ice is made, it’s best to deactivate the mode. Most Samsung refrigerators with Power Freeze will automatically switch off the function after a set period (typically a few hours) to conserve energy.
4. Does Power Freeze consume a lot of energy?
Yes, Power Freeze does consume more energy than normal operation due to the increased workload on the compressor. However, the duration is limited, usually to a few hours. If used sparingly and deactivated once the desired freezing is achieved, the overall energy impact is manageable. Modern Samsung refrigerators are designed with energy efficiency in mind, even when using Power Freeze.

6. What types of food benefit most from Power Freeze?
Foods that are susceptible to texture and flavor degradation during slow freezing benefit the most from Power Freeze. This includes:
- Meat: Preserves the texture and reduces moisture loss.
- Fish: Maintains freshness and prevents freezer burn.
- Fruits and Vegetables: Minimizes ice crystal formation, preserving cell structure.
- Homemade Ice Cream/Desserts: Ensures a smoother, less icy texture.
- Leftovers: Freezing quickly helps maintain quality and prevents bacterial growth.
7. How does Power Freeze differ from Power Cool?
While both Power Freeze and Power Cool are rapid cooling functions, they target different compartments. Power Freeze focuses on rapidly lowering the temperature in the freezer, while Power Cool focuses on the refrigerator compartment. Power Cool is ideal for quickly chilling groceries or beverages in the refrigerator section, while Power Freeze is specifically designed for freezing food items in the freezer.
8. Will Power Freeze damage my food if left on too long?
While unlikely to “damage” your food, leaving Power Freeze on unnecessarily long can lead to excessive freezing, potentially causing freezer burn if the food is not properly sealed. Freezer burn occurs when moisture escapes from the surface of the food, leading to dehydration and a change in texture and taste. It’s always best to monitor the freezing process and deactivate Power Freeze once the desired result is achieved.
9. My Power Freeze isn’t working. What could be the problem?
If Power Freeze isn’t functioning as expected, several factors could be responsible:
- Overloaded Freezer: An overstuffed freezer can restrict airflow and reduce the efficiency of Power Freeze.
- Incorrect Temperature Settings: Ensure the freezer temperature is set to the appropriate level.
- Faulty Compressor: A malfunctioning compressor can hinder the cooling process.
- Dirty Condenser Coils: Dirty condenser coils can reduce the refrigerator’s cooling capacity.
- Defective Door Seal: A compromised door seal can allow warm air to enter, negating the effects of Power Freeze.
- Software Glitch: Occasionally, a software glitch can prevent the function from activating. Try unplugging the refrigerator for a few minutes and then plugging it back in to reset the system.
If you suspect a mechanical issue, it’s best to contact a qualified appliance repair technician.

11. Is Power Freeze available on all Samsung refrigerator models?
No, Power Freeze is not available on all Samsung refrigerator models. It’s typically found on mid-range to high-end models that feature advanced cooling technologies. Check the product specifications of your specific model to confirm whether it includes Power Freeze functionality.
12. How do I clean the condenser coils to improve Power Freeze efficiency?
Cleaning the condenser coils is crucial for maintaining optimal refrigerator performance, including the efficiency of Power Freeze. Here’s how to do it:
- Unplug the Refrigerator: Always disconnect the refrigerator from the power outlet before cleaning.
- Locate the Coils: Condenser coils are typically located at the back or bottom of the refrigerator.
- Vacuum the Coils: Use a vacuum cleaner with a brush attachment to gently remove dust and debris from the coils.
- Wipe with a Damp Cloth: For stubborn dirt, wipe the coils with a damp cloth, ensuring they are completely dry before plugging the refrigerator back in.
Regular cleaning (every 6-12 months) will help improve airflow and ensure your Power Freeze function operates at its best.
